摘要
本文针对气相法流化床结块的问题,分析了静电、床层料位、颗粒形态、催化剂等对结块的影响,并提出了通过反应器预处理、控制杂质含量、消除静电、调节催化剂加料系统、控制料位、超声波除垢等措施,可防止和减少聚乙烯流化床结块,利于装置的长周期运行。
This paper aims at the phenomenon of agglomeration in gas phase fluidized bed,the effects of static electricity,bed level,particle morphology and catalyst etc.on agglomeration were analyzed.The measures such as reactor pretreatment,controlling impurity content,eliminating static electricity,adjusting catalyst feeding system and ultrasonic descaling are put forward to prevent and reduce the agglomeration of polyethylene fluidized bed,which is conducive to long-term operation of the unit.
